Abstract

Streak Tube Imaging Lidar (STIL) is a promising imaging system as its high frame rate and good image quality, which can help SAR image the short scale ocean wave. In this paper, we based on laser radar equation, simulate streak imaging of short scale ocean wave by the optical scattering model. Through the experiment in Yellow Sea in China, we get the real short scale ocean wave images by using STIL. According to the inversion algorithm, we get restoration imaging of ocean surface with short scale ocean wave.
